Plot Summary
Killer Siblings is a true-crime docuseries that delves into the chilling stories of siblings who have committed heinous crimes together. Each episode unravels the complex dynamics within these familial relationships, exploring the psychological factors and circumstances that led them down a path of violence. The series aims to understand the shared motivations and the intricate web of their criminal activities.
